10 Amazing jQuery Carousel Plugins
10 stunning jQuery carousel plugins to rejuvenate your website! Carousel plug-ins are essentially a display tool for continuously looping display media (for example, images are displayed at time intervals to ensure that each image is displayed on its turn). Enjoy it!
-
rCarousel
A continuous carousel plug-in based on jQuery UI. 
-
Theatre Carousel
A stunning carousel plug-in. You can add it to your page and this tutorial will guide you on how. 
-
Barousel
A jQuery plugin that easily creates simple carousels, where each slide is defined by an image and any type of related content. 
-
3D Carousel
A 3D carousel created based on image list with reflection effect and animation control through mouse position. 
-
Liquid Carousel Plugin
A jQuery plug-in designed for fluid design. Whenever the carousel container is resized, the number of items in the list changes to accommodate the new width. 
-
carouFredSel
A plugin that can convert any type of HTML element into a carousel. It can scroll one or more items horizontally or vertically at the same time, loop infinitely, and scroll through user interaction or automatically. 
-
k3dCarousel
This tutorial will guide you how to use it. 
-
jQuery Feature Carousel
This plugin is designed to display featured stories on the home page of the website, but can be used for any purpose and is highly customizable. It always displays three images at the same time, the rest are hidden behind the middle image. 
-
iCarousel
An open source (free) JavaScript tool for creating carousel-like widgets. 
-
Billy: an Elegant Carousel Plugin
Billy is a basic scrolling carousel plug-in out of the box, easy to implement. Even people with limited knowledge of HTML or JavaScript can add it to the page in minutes. 
FAQs on enhancing websites with the top 10 jQuery carousel plug-ins
What is jQuery carousel plugin?
jQuery Carousel Plugin is a software that allows you to create carousel-style slideshows on your website. This type of slideshow is often used to display multiple images or other content in a compact and user-friendly manner. Carousel can be set to automatically rotate, or users can scroll through content manually. The jQuery carousel plugin is built with the popular JavaScript library jQuery, making it compatible with most web browsers and easy to integrate into your website.
How to install jQuery carousel plug-in?
Installing the jQuery carousel plug-in requires several steps. First, you need to download the plugin file and include it in the HTML of your website. This usually involves adding a link to the plugin CSS file at the head of the HTML and adding a link to the plugin JavaScript file at the end of the HTML body. Then you need to initialize the plugin with the script tag. This involves selecting the HTML element to be converted to a carousel and calling the plugin's function on it. The exact code you need to use will depend on the specific plugin you are using.
Can I customize the look and feel of the carousel?
Yes, most jQuery carousel plug-ins allow you to customize the look and feel of the carousel to match the design of your website. This can usually be done by modifying the plugin's CSS file. Some plugins also provide options for customizing carousel behavior, such as rotation speed, transition effects between slides, and whether navigation controls are displayed.
Is the jQuery carousel plug-in responsive?
Many jQuery carousel plug-ins are designed to be responsive, which means they automatically resize and layout to suit different screen sizes. This makes them an excellent choice for websites that need to be accessible on both desktop and mobile devices. However, not all plugins are responsive, so it is important to check this feature before selecting a plugin.
If I don't know how to write the code, can I use the jQuery carousel plugin?
While installing and customizing jQuery carousel plug-ins does require some HTML, CSS, and JavaScript knowledge, many plug-ins are designed to be very user-friendly and come with detailed documentation to guide you through the process. There are also many online tutorials and resources to help you learn the necessary skills.
Can I use multiple carousels on the same page?
Yes, most jQuery carousel plugins allow you to use multiple carousels on the same page. Each carousel runs independently, so you can customize each carousel to display different content or run in different ways.
Is the jQuery carousel plug-in suitable for all web browsers?
jQuery carousel plug-in is built using jQuery (a JavaScript library compatible with all modern web browsers). However, some older browsers may not support all the features of jQuery, which may affect the functionality of the carousel. It is best to test your carousel in multiple browsers to make sure it works as expected.
Can I add interactive elements to the carousel?
Yes, many jQuery carousel plug-ins allow you to add interactive elements such as buttons, links, or forms to the carousel. This can be a great way to attract website visitors and encourage them to interact with your content.
How to update jQuery carousel plug-in?
Updating jQuery carousel plug-ins usually involves downloading the latest version of the plug-in file and replacing old files on the website. Be sure to keep your plugins up to date to make sure they continue to work properly and benefit from any new features or bug fixes.
Can I use jQuery carousel plugin on a commercial website?
Most jQuery carousel plug-ins are free to use, including on commercial websites. However, some plugins may require a commercially used license, so be sure to check the Terms of Use before installing the plugin to your website.
